DIY Solar Panels UK: A Step-by-Step Guide to Building Your Own Solar System

As more and more people in the UK turn to renewable energy, the popularity of DIY solar panels has grown. By installing your own solar panels, you can save money on energy bills and reduce your carbon footprint. However, building your own solar system may seem like a daunting task. That’s why we’ve created a step-by-step guide to help you through the process.

Step 1: Determine Your Energy Needs

Before you start building your solar system, you need to determine how much energy you use. This will help you determine the size of the solar panel system you need to install. To find out your energy usage, look at your energy bills and identify the average amount of energy you use per day.

Step 2: Decide on the Type of Solar Panels

There are two types of solar panels: monocrystalline and polycrystalline. Monocrystalline panels are more expensive, but they are also more efficient and take up less space. Polycrystalline panels are cheaper but take up more space and are slightly less efficient. Decide which type of panel is right for you based on your energy needs and budget.

Step 3: Purchase Your Solar Panels

Once you have determined the type and size of solar panel system you need, it’s time to purchase your solar panels. You can find solar panels online or in local hardware stores. Compare prices and make sure you are getting the best deal.

Step 4: Gather Your Tools

You will need a few basic tools to install your solar panels. These include a drill, screwdriver, wire cutters, and safety equipment such as gloves and safety glasses. Make sure you have all the necessary tools before you start installation.

Step 5: Install Your Solar Panels

Now it’s time to start installing your solar panels. This is where things can get tricky, so it’s important to follow the instructions carefully. Start by mounting the panels on the roof or other suitable location. Then, connect the panels to the inverter, which converts the DC power generated by the panels into AC power for your home. Finally, connect the inverter to your home’s electrical system.

Step 6: Test Your Solar System

After your solar system is installed, it’s important to test it to make sure it’s working properly. You can use a multimeter to test the voltage output of the panels and inverter. If you are not comfortable doing this yourself, you may want to hire a professional to test your system.

Step 7: Enjoy Your Savings

Once your solar system is up and running, you can sit back and enjoy the savings on your energy bills. You will also be doing your part to reduce your carbon footprint and help the environment.
